The Newfoundland and Labrador Psychology Board (NLPB) is the regulatory body overseeing the practice of psychology in the province of Newfoundland and Labrador, Canada, under the authority of the Psychologists Act of 2005. The Board is composed of five elected Registered Psychologists and two Public Members appointed by the Minister of Health and Community Services, ensuring adherence to professional standards and ethical guidelines.
Registered Psychologists in the province must comply with the Canadian Code of Ethics for Psychologists and the NLPB Standards of Professional Conduct. The Board offers two levels of registration: Full Registration for independent practice and Provisional Registration, which requires supervision by a fully registered psychologist, thereby safeguarding the quality of psychological services provided to the public.
